TROUBLESHOOTING GUIDE 5.
PS SENSOR ERRORS
Symptom and Reason: “CHECK PS1” or “CHECK PS2” is displayed after power on.
This error is caused by PS1 and PS2 sensor problem and may be due to various reasons
including debris on the sensors and reflectors, cracked reflectors, damaged sensors,
damaged cables, poor or damage connectors, or MECHA/MAIN board issues.
5.1.
Causes and Solution: To isolate the failing component it is recommended to test the
below steps in the given order:
1. Check the sensors in Service menu
A.) Enter Service menu -> [1] Diagnosis -> [7] Sensor Detail
B.) Check ‘Upper Door’ (PS1) and ‘Lower Door’ (PS2)
C.) ‘1’ means the door is open. If all the doors are closed but the level is ‘1’,
then the sensor is not working.
